Historic Coast Guard Boathouse
Cared for by the Garibaldi Cultural Heritage Initiative, this historic boathouse built in 1936 was used as a Coast Guard life-saving station to help ships and fishing boats in Tillamook Bay. The boathouse, undergoing a preservation effort, has a gallery of historic interpretive signage and photos, and offers a unique venue for special events. It is one of the most photographed buildings on the Oregon Coast, thanks to its long boardwalk pier where people cast fishing lines and crab pots.
